You can render all layers to Adobe Photoshop (PSD) format.

A PSD file is created during a render with each layer in your scene as a separate layer in this PSD file and with all blending modes specified as they were specified in the Maya file. When you open this file in Adobe Photoshop, each render layer in your Maya scene will have a corresponding layer and blend mode in the PSD.
The PSD file is rendered directly to the image directory of your project and not in a subdirectory.
To render to PSD layer file format
- In the
Common tab of the
Render Settings, select
PSD layered (psd) from the
Image Format list.
You can open the PSD file created in Adobe Photoshop.
